Crispy and Delicious Air Fried Falafel

Historical Context: The exact origin of falafel is a subject of culinary debate, with claims from both Egypt and the Levant. Some food historians even suggest that falafel may have been inspired by ancient Roman deep-fried chickpea recipes. Regardless of its origins, falafel has become a beloved dish worldwide, finding a special place in the hearts of vegetarians and food enthusiasts alike.

Preparation:

Step 1: Prepare the Chickpeas Start by soaking the dried chickpeas in cold water for at least 12 hours or overnight. Once soaked, drain them thoroughly.

Step 2: Blend the Ingredients In a food processor, combine the soaked and drained chickpeas, chopped onion, minced garlic, fresh parsley, cilantro, cumin, coriander, cayenne pepper, salt, and pepper. Pulse until the mixture is finely chopped but not pureed; it should resemble coarse sand.

Step 3: Add Binding Agents Transfer the mixture to a mixing bowl and sprinkle in the baking powder and 4 tablespoons of all-purpose flour. Mix well until the ingredients are evenly distributed. If the mixture seems too loose to hold together, add more flour, one tablespoon at a time, until it forms a cohesive dough.

Step 4: Shape the Falafel Using your hands, shape the mixture into small, uniform balls, about 1 1/2 inches in diameter. Place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. You can lightly wet your hands with water to prevent sticking while shaping.

Step 5: Preheat the Air Fryer Preheat your air fryer to 370°F (190°C).

Step 6: Air Fry the Falafel Lightly spray the falafel balls with cooking spray or brush them with a small amount of olive oil. Place them in the preheated air fryer basket in a single layer, making sure they have some space around each for even cooking. Depending on the size of your air fryer, you may need to cook them in batches.

Step 7: Air Fry Until Golden Cook the falafel for about 12 minutes, flipping them halfway through the cooking time to ensure even browning. They should become golden and crisp on the outside while remaining tender on the inside.

Step 8: Serve and Enjoy! Once the falafel are done, remove them from the air fryer and let them cool for a few minutes before serving. Enjoy them in pita bread with your favorite tahini sauce, fresh vegetables, and pickles for a satisfying and healthier twist on a classic Middle Eastern dish.

prep time
20 minutes.
cooking time
12 minutes.
servings
4 servings.
total time
32 minutes.

Equipment

  • Food processor

  • Air fryer

  • Mixing bowl

  • Spatula

  • Baking sheet

  • Parchment paper

Ingredients

  • 1 ½ cups dried chickpeas (not canned)

  • 1 small onion, roughly chopped

  • 4 cloves garlic, minced

  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ped

  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ped

  • 1 teaspoon cumin

  • 1 teaspoon coriander

  • 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per (adjust to taste)

  • Salt and pepper to taste

  • 1 teaspoon baking powder

  • 4-6 tablespoons all-purpose flour

  • Cooking spray or a small amount of olive oil for air frying
